Drop the Act, It’s Exhausting!: Free Yourself from Your So-Called Put-Together Life
Drop the Act, It s Exhausting is one woman s call to all women to embrace the imperfections in their lives and to air their improper thoughts about relationships, love, sex, parenting, careers, self-esteem, and self-image. By no longer being ashamed or apologetic about how they "really feel, women will become more aware of who they are and more accepting of themselves and one another. With wit, candor, and refreshingly blunt observations, Beth Thomas Cohen proves herself the prime example of how freeing, fun, and unifying it can be to drop the act and live a not so put-together life."
Beth Thomas Cohen has been in the fashion industry for sixteen years. As cofounder of the public relations agency B’ squared Public Relations, Beth launched new fashion brands and breathed life into older ones. She previously worked as senior director at Lividini & Co., in-house public relations director at the luxury/accessories company Lambertson Truex, and worked in the fashion department at O, The Oprah Magazine. She lives in New Jersey with her husband and children.
